Every loving parent is going to get by hook or crook the best equipment and training they can for their kiddos. I assumed that was a given among you folks who contribute here. What I was objecting to is giving anyone else your kid's heart and mind to play with. You just can't delegate that.

I also mentioned that all the name brand baseball equipment companies are extremely competitive. If one comes up with a better bat, it is copied by all the competitors soonest. Any advantage is momentary.
